• The overload device of the DRH wire rope hoist has been duly registered and calibrated by
dONATI
SOLLEVAMENTI S.r.l.
considering the
lifting capacity and the FEM service group foreseen for the hoist.
Following the test run , the micrometric adjusting screw for the calibrations
-1-
is blocked with the grub screw
-2-
and subjected to tamperproof sealing (fig. 100).
• The overload device is a component with the safety function of
preventing overload
and the calibrations
MUST
NOT
be changed (fig. 101).
• Where a new calibration is necessary, such an operation
MUST BE
performed by the technical service of
dONATI
SOLLEVAMENTI S.r.l.
or by staff trained and authorized by the company.
Having done the functional ”empty” test runs, proceed to the dynamic test runs; these test runs are carried out with
weights of value corresponding to the lifting capacity of the label plate of the hoist increased by the coefficient of
overload 1.1 (load equal to 110% of the nominal load). The static test runs are done with a coefficient of overload
of 1.25 (load equal to 125% of the nominal load).

• The overload device MuST be connected to the control board according to the
instructions detailed in the related electrical circuit diagrams.
• The overload device MuST NOT be tampered with and the calibrations MuST NOT be
modified.
• The DRH electric wire rope hoists and related trolleys have been tested by the manufacturer to
ascertain their functional and performance response. However such testing must be repeated after
installation in order to ensure the optimal, safe functional performance of the hoist and trolley in
their place of installation.
• The testing phases require a precise sequence of operations which, described as follows must be
strictly followed by the technicians in charge.
All tests must be carried out in no windy conditions.

• Empty test runs:
• activate the switch/disconnecting switch
• put the emergency stop switch in the position which allows movement
• press the “gear/alarm” button (if available)
• check the lifting function by pressing the ascent/descent buttons
• check the travelling function by pressing the right/left buttons
• in the case of movements at two speeds check the functionality
• check the functioning of the electrical limit switches of all the movements.
• Dynamic test runs:
• prepare adequate weights for the test runs with load equal to
nominal lifting capacity x 1.1
and suitable
equipment for the harnessing and lifting of the load
• harness the load, taking care to position the hook vertically to avoid skew rope falls
• slowly tension the sling so as not to cause tearing, if available do the test runs with load using the “slow” speed
• slowly lift the load and check that this happens with no difficulty and that there are no anomalous noises, clear
deformations or sagging in the structure
• repeat the test run at maximum speed, doing the preceding checks
• check the functionality of the “ascent and descent” limit switches
• check the functionality of the lifting brake, checking that the weight is braked in adequate time and that there
is no skidding of the load, after releasing the button.
• carry out the same checks also for the trolley travelling movements, checking the functionality of the “right and
left” limit switches, without bringing the load to the maximum height (lift it to a height of one metre from the
ground).
• operate first at slow speed, if available, and then at maximum speed
• check the correct sliding of the trolley on the girder, and ascertain that there are no noises, evident deformations
or anomalous sagging of the structures.
• check the functioning of the “emergency stop” button which must stop and inhibit all the movements. Any
function of the hoist and/or trolley must stop, in the shortest possible time and space, without showing
anomalies, side skids, dangerous oscillations, etc. which threaten the stability.
• check the braking spaces and stopping spaces during lifting and travelling.
Indicative amplitude of these spaces:
• in the descent movement with maximum load it is between 6 and 8 cm
• in the travelling movement of the trolley, which moves at a speed of 16 or 20 m/min, it is between 15 and
30 cm.
• In both cases consistent oscillations of the load must be avoided.
• Static test run:
•
lift the load used for the dynamic test runs, stop it in suspended position at a height of 50 cm, gradually apply weights
on it until reaching an overload value equal to 25% of the nominal maximum lifting capacity.
• leave the weight suspended for no less than 10 minutes.
•
check that the weight suspended (load + overload) does not yield (the lifting brake must not skid) and that there are
no evident deformations or sagging of the structure.
•
check the functioning of the overload device which must exclude and disactivate all the functions of the hoist and of
the trolley with the exclusion of the descent movement.
During the static test the overload device must disactivate the ascenting movement, the descenting
movement must not be activated.
The testing of the hoist/trolley must be repeated at the annual checks, see point 6.3.4. The results of the
testing must be noted in the checks register, see chapter 8.
